SI Fundamentals Masterclass
Masterclass objectives:
- Gain a clear understanding of the fundamental concepts of signal integrity (SI) and their critical role in modern electronic designs.
- Learn practical design techniques to enhance signal performance in PCBs.
- Develop confidence in identifying and resolving signal integrity issues effectively.
